LOUISVILLE, Ky. (WDRB) -- Was Saturday's spectacular Thunder Over Louisville an attendance record breaker? We'll never know.

The Kentucky Derby Festival said it won't provide estimated crowd numbers like it has done in the past because assessing attendance has gotten tougher.

Thunder is not a ticketed event, so there is no exact head count. Plus, there are several different places to watch along the waterfront in Kentucky and Indiana, and many of them are indoors.

KDF told WDRB News that it's not about the numbers but the experience and the moment. It said that this year's Thunder was better than it could've imagined.

The return of the airshow and fireworks to the Louisville waterfront did bring out large crowds downtown and in southern Indiana. Saturday's perfect weather also added to speculation that the huge crowd set a record.
